How much does it cost to rent a home in Brookridge Community?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Brookridge Community 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,409 | $1,199 | $1,700 |
| Brookridge Community 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,875 | $1,299 | $3,150 |
| Brookridge Community 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,392 | $1,990 | $3,950 |
| Brookridge Community 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,245 | $2,245 | $2,245 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Brookridge Community
What type of rentals are currently available in Brookridge Community?
There are currently 5 Apartments for Rent in Brookridge Community, FL with pricing that ranges from $1,799 to $2,700. There are also 42 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Brookridge Community ranging from $1,199 to $3,950.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Brookridge Community?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Brookridge Community ranges from $1,199 to $3,950 with an average monthly rent of $1,980.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Brookridge Community?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Brookridge Community range from $1,799 to $2,700,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,299 to $3,150.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,990 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,899.
